§ 151.0241

Ask AI about this
(a) In this section, 'disaster- or emergency-related work,' 'disaster response period,' and 'out-of-state business entity' have the meanings assigned by Section 112.003, Business & Commerce Code.(b) An out-of-state business entity is not engaged in business in this state for purposes of Sections 151.107 and 151.403 or any other provision of this chapter applicable to a person engaged in business in this state if the entity's physical presence in this state is solely from the entity's performance of disaster- or emergency-related work during a disaster response period. Added by Acts 2015, 84th Leg., R.S., Ch. 559 (H.B. 2358), Sec. 2(a), eff. June 16, 2015.
